Duradek Vinyl Roofing
Duradek is a waterproof walkable membrane ideal for roof decks, patios, or balconies, and safe for furniture. Available in a variety of colors and patterns, is the most customizable flat roofing system. With proper installation and maintenance, it can have a useful lifespan up to 12-15 years. It is recommended to use on a roof slope of 0.25/ft. Duradek provides a 15-year waterproofing warranty when installed by a trained applicator.
EPDM Rubber Roofing
Ethylene Propylene Diene Monomer. A durable, synthetic rubber roofing membrane designed to withstand variable environments and temperatures. Due to its composition, it can have a useful lifespan over 50 years when installed via the fully-adhered method and proper maintenance. It Is recommended to use on a roof slope of 0.25/12-2/12. Red Shield Limited Warranty – Only approved contractors can offer up to a 25-year warranty on material AND workmanship on commercial buildings.
TPO Roofing
Thermoplastic Polyolefin. A single-ply roofing membrane designed to be heat-reflective and energy efficient. The blend of rubbers and fillers add to its durability and flexibility, it can have a useful lifespan up to 30 years. It is recommended to use on a roof slope of 0.25/12-4/12. TPO offers the same warranty options as EPDM, but is a great choice for solar reflectivity and restaurant applications.

Is my roof too low of a slope for shingles?
Shingles work best on roofs with a steeper pitch. When the slope of a roof drops below a 3/12 pitch (that means it rises less than 3 inches for every 12 inches of horizontal run), it’s considered too low for shingles. At that point, shingles are more likely to leak because water doesn’t run off as quickly. For these roofs, a flat roof membrane is the right solution to keep your home properly protected.
How long do flat roofs typically last?
Flat roof membranes typically last 20 to 25 years. Longevity of a flat roof can be affected by things like wear and tear and exposure to the elements. For instance, our Duradek walkable roof membrane can last 20 years, but if it is walked on excessively and with lots of furniture, the life span might be reduced. Another example is if a single ply membrane such as TPO is in a protected area that does not get full sun exposure, it might get 25 to 30 years of life, vs. the same material in a coastal environment that faces the sun might get only 20 years.
Are flat roof more likely to leak than pitched roofs?
Just the opposite! If the right material is used and installed correctly, then a flat roof is much more watertight than a sloped roof. We can use our flat roof materials to make swimming pool liners and will remain 100% watertight. Conversely, sloped roofs utilize a layered system that sheds water, and relies on the downward flow of water. This means that if rain is driven uphill in such events like hurricanes, or there is blockage of flow due to something like debris, water can get between the layers and into the roof system.
What maintenance does a flat roof require?
All roofs require some amount of maintenance in order to allow the roof to reach its full life expectancy. Flat roofs sometimes have additional areas of maintenance. If there are things like roof drains, scuppers, pitch pockets, etc. then those items should be checked regularly.
Do these roofing systems come with a warranty?
Yes, warranties on the material against defects are standard with flat roofing material. The material warranties range from 10 to 25 years. Workmanship warranties are handled by the contractor but there are also additional warranties available from the manufacturer if the contractor is in an approved contractor program that the manufacturer offers. These approved contractor programs are one of the best ways to know if your contractor is top-notch because the manufacturer has vetted them and required training.
How do I know which flat roofing system is right for me?
Selecting the right system for your application is based on slope of the roof, whether there will be any foot traffic on it, what color you want it to be, and if there are any unusual features such as kitchen exhaust fans that emit grease. There are multiple options for each scenario, so working with an experienced roofing professional is important.
